Dalam menaikkan kinerja serta mengevaluasi kualitas, perusahaan publik membutuhkan feedback dari masyarakat / konsumen yang bisa didapat melalui media sosial. Sebagai pengguna media sosial Twitter terbesar ketiga di dunia, tweet yang beredar di Indonesia memiliki potensi meningkatkan reputasi dan citra perusahaan. Dengan memanfaatkan algoritma Deep Neural Network (DNN), neural network yang tersusun dari layer yang jumlahnya lebih dari satu, didapati hasil analisa sentimen pada Twitter berbahasa Indonesia menjadi lebih baik dibanding dengan metode lainnya. Penelitian ini menganalisa sentimen melalui tweet dari masyarakat Indonesia terhadap sejumlah perusahaan publik dengan menggunakan DNN. Data Tweet sebanyak 5504 record didapat dengan melakukan crawling melalui Application Programming Interface (API) Twitter yang selanjutnya dilakukan preprocessing (cleansing, case folding, formalisasi, stemming, dan tokenisasi). Proses labeling dilakukan untuk 3902 record dengan memanfaatkan aplikasi Sentiment Strength Detection. Tahap pelatihan model dilakukan menggunakan algoritma DNN dengan variasi jumlah hidden layer, susunan node, dan nilai learning rate. Eksperimen dengan proporsi data training dan testing sebesar 90:10 memberikan hasil performa terbaik. Model tersusun dengan 3 hidden layer dengan susunan node tiap layer pada model tersebut yaitu 128, 256, 128 node dan menggunakan learning rate sebesar 0.005, model mampu menghasilkan nilai akurasi mencapai 88.72%.

Abstract Skin cancer has become a great concern for people's wellness. With the popularization of machine learning, a considerable amount of data about skin cancer has been created. However, applications on the market featuring skin cancer diagnosis have barely utilized the data. In this paper, we have designed a web application to diagnose skin cancer with the CNN model and Chatterbot API. First, the application allows the user to upload an image of the user's skin. Next, a CNN model is trained with a huge amount of pre-taken images to make predictions about whether the skin is affected by skin cancer, and if the answer is yes, which kind of skin cancer the uploaded image can be classified. Last, a chatbot using the Chatterbot API is trained with hundreds of answers and questions asked and answered on the internet to interact with and give feedback to the user based on the information provided by the CNN model. The application has achieved significant performance in making classifications and has acquired the ability to interact with users. The CNN model has reached an accuracy of 0.95 in making classifications, and the chatbot can answer more than 100 questions about skin cancer. We have also done a great job on connecting the backend based on the CNN model as well as the Chatterbot API and the frontend based on the VUE Javascript framework.

Customer churn is the most important problem in the business world, especially in the telecommunications industry, because it greatly influences company profits. Getting new customers for a company is much more difficult and expensive than retaining existing customers. Machine learning, part of data mining, is a sub-field of artificial intelligence widely used to make predictions, including predicting customer churn. Deep neural network (DNN) has been used for churn prediction, but selecting hyperparameters in modeling requires more time and effort, making the process more challenging for the researcher. Therefore, the purpose of this study is to propose a better architecture for the DNN algorithm by using a hard tuner to obtain more optimal hyperparameters. The tuning hyperparameter used is random search in determining the number of nodes in each hidden layer, dropout, and learning rate. In addition, this study also uses three variations of the number of hidden layers, two variations of the activation function, namely rectified linear unit (ReLu) and Sigmoid, then uses five variations of the optimizer (stochastic gradient descent (SGD), adaptive moment estimation (Adam), adaptive gradient algorithm (Adagrad), Adadelta, and root mean square propagation (RMSprop)). Experiments show that the DNN algorithm using hyperparameter tuning random search produces a performance value of 83.09 % accuracy using three hidden layers, the number of nodes in each hidden layer is [20, 35, 15], using the RMSprop optimizer, dropout 0.1, the learning rate is 0.01, with the fastest tuning time of 21 seconds. Better than modeling using k-nearest neighbor (K-NN), random forest (RF), and decision tree (DT) as comparison algorithms.

Pada Tahun 2019 Organisasi Kesehatan Dunia (WHO) mendudukkan stroke sebagai tujuh dari sepuluh penyebab utama kematian. Kementerian Kesehatan menggolongkan stroke sebagai penyakit katastropik karena dampaknya luas secara ekonomi dan sosial. Oleh karena itu, diperlukan peran dari teknologi informasi untuk memprediksi stroke guna pencegahan dan perawatan dini. Analisis data yang memiliki kelas tidak seimbang mengakibatkan ketidakakuratan dalam memprediksi stroke. Penelitian ini membandingkan tiga teknik oversampling untuk mendapatkan model prediksi yang lebih baik. Data kelas yang sudah diseimbangkan diuji menggunakan tiga model Arsitektur Deep Neural Network (DNN) dengan melakukan optimasi pada beberapa parameter yaitu optimizer, learning rate dan epoch. Hasil paling baik didapatkan teknik oversampling SMOTETomek dan Arsitektur DNN dengan lima hidden layer, optimasi Adam, learning rate 0.001 dan jumlah epoch 500. Skor akurasi, presisi, recall, dan f1-score masing-masing mendapatkan 0.96, 0.9614, 0.9608 dan 0.9611.

Availability the Application Programming Interface (API) for third-party applications on Android devices provides an opportunity to monitor Android devices with each other. This is used to create an application that can facilitate parents in child supervision through Android devices owned. In this study, some features added to the classification of image content on Android devices related to negative content. In this case, researchers using Clarifai API. The result of this research is to produce a system which has feature, give a report of image file contained in target smartphone and can do deletion on the image file, receive browser history report and can directly visit in the application, receive a report of child location and can be directly contacted via this application. This application works well on the Android Lollipop (API Level 22). Index Terms— Application Programming Interface(API), Monitoring, Negative Content, Children, Parent.
